pinctrl: sh-pfc: r8a77990: Add HSCIF pins, groups, and functions
authorTakeshi Kihara <takeshi.kihara.df@renesas.com>
Thu, 15 Nov 2018 16:47:07 +0000 (01:47 +0900)
committerGeert Uytterhoeven <geert+renesas@glider.be>
Mon, 19 Nov 2018 09:43:51 +0000 (10:43 +0100)
This patch adds HSCIF{0,1,2,3,4} pins, groups and functions to
the R8A77990 SoC.
